📄 misc.h
字号:
/************************************************************************************
Copyright (c) 1999-2005 Zhejiang Nanwang
Multimedia Information CO. LTD.
PROPRIETARY RIGHTS of Zhejiang Nanwang Multimedia Information
CO., LTD.are involved in the subject matter of this material.
All manufacturing, reproduction, use, and sales rights pertaining to
this subject matter are governed by the license agreement.
******************************************************************************************
FILE NAME
misc.c - 杂项IO控制接口
******************************************************************************************
modification history
2005-11-23 8:59 wangb create the file
******************************************************************************************/
#ifndef INC_MISC_H
#define INC_MISC_H
#ifdef __cplusplus
extern "C" {
#endif
#include "ks8695p.h"
#define EXTIO2ADDR (EXT_IO_BANK_2 + 0x10)
/*MiscIoCtrl 功能码定义*/
#define GETIOALARM 1
#define RUNLEDSETTING 2 /*运行指示灯控制*/
#define BUZZERSETTING 3 /*蜂鸣器控制*/
#define VIDEOSETTING 4 /*视频口指示灯控制*/
#define CHIPRESETSETTING 5 /*芯片复位控制*/
#define WATCHDOGENABLESETTING 6 /*watchdog使能控制*/
#define WATCHDOGCTRL 7 /*watchdog 喂狗控制*/
#define SERIALSETTING 8 /*串口指示灯控制*/
/*芯片复位控制定义*/
#define DM642SOFTRESET 0x0 /*DM642复位*/
#define IDECLIPSOFTRESET 0x1 /*IDE复位*/
#define S752BSOFTRESET 0x2 /*串口复位*/
#define VIDEO1SOFTRESET 0x3 /*视频口1复位*/
#define VIDEO2SOFTRESET 0x4 /*视频口2复位*/
#define VIDEO3SOFTRESET 0x5 /*视频口3复位*/
#define VIDEO4SOFTRESET 0x6 /*视频口4复位*/
#define FLASHSOFTRESET 0x7 /*FLASH复位*/
/* LED ,watchdog使能控制定义*/
#ifndef ON
#define ON 1
#endif
#ifndef OFF
#define OFF 0
#endif
int MiscIoCtrl(int dwFunc,int dwCtrl,int dwChan,int *dwRet);
#ifdef __cplusplus
}
#endif
#endif
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-